Abstract: Наведено результати досліджень динаміки популяції фаг-бактерія при використанні різних титрів бактеріофага SAvB14 та чутливої до нього культури S. aureus var. bovis. Встановлено, що чим вищий титр фагів, тим інтенсивніше прогресує фагова інфекція. При цьому внесення фага з титром 10-8 БУО/см3 ефективніше знищує S. аureus, ніж внесення фаголізату з меншим вмістом SAvB14.
Nowadays bactheriophage treatment is more often seen as alternative to antibiotics. But collaborative mechanism of bacterial virus is not enough studied. The aim of work is to research the dynamic of bacterial virus population using different titres of bacteriophage SAvB14 and sensitive to its culture S. aureus var. bovis. To estimate the influence of bacteriophage Phage SAvB14 on amount of viable bacteria S. aureus var. bovis was taken 1 ml of phagolysate with titer of phagolysate with titers 10-6, 10-7, 10-8, 10-9BU/ml in 9 ml of nutrient broth with daily culture of tested microorganisms and kept during 12 hours. The amount of viable staphylococcus was defined every 2 hours by sowing them in the environment BD Baird-Parker Agar (HiMedia, India) according to standard methodic. The investigation was made three times. Strains S. aureus var. Bovis were used in the research, that were lysed by bacteriophage Phage SAvB14 in Otto method. The results of investigation show, that different titers of bacteriophage SAvB14 adversely affected on the target bacteria S. aureus during first two hours. However, the more titer of phage, the more progress phage infection. Staphylococcus content when interacting with phages, the titer of which 10-6BU / cm3 decreases in 1.6 times in12 hours of interaction, compared with the number of S. aureus var. bovis in broth without bacteriophage. The same results can be shown at a titer of 10-9 BU /cm3 - the content of S. aureus decreased in 2.3 times compared to the control. The obtained data indicate that the introduction of phage with a titer of 10-8BU / cm3 in 1.3 times more effectively destroys S. Aureus than the introduction of phagolysate with a titer of 10-7BU/cm3, and in 1.5 times compared with titer 10-6 BU/cm3. The results obtained from the research of the effect of phage with a titer of 10-9 BU/cm3, almost do not differ from obtained when testing a titer of 10-8BU/cm3. Therefore, to obtain desirable therapeutic effect in the use of phage drugs for the treatment of mastitis caused by S. aureus var. bovis, we recommend the use of phagolysate with a titer of at least 10-8BU / cm3.
